2023年【零声教育】13代C/C++Linux服务器开发高级架构师课程体系分析

对于零声教育的C/C++Linux服务器高级架构师的课程到2022目前已经迭代到13代了,像之前小编也总结过,但是课程每期都有做一定的更新,也是为了更好的完善课程跟上目前互联网大厂的岗位技术需求,之前课程里面也包含了一些小的分支,其中就有音视频开发、Linux内核开发、DPDK、golang等等一些程序员所需要的硬核技术。今天总结分析是2023年最新的课程体系。 

课程定位为中高级课程,学习这个课程也有一定的要求,以下是适应学习的一些人群:

1.从事业务开发多年,对底层原理理解不够深入的在职工程师

2.从事嵌入式方向开发,想转入互联网开发的在职工程师

3.从事Qt/MFC等桌面开发的,薪资多年涨幅不大的在职工程师

4.从事非开发岗位(算法岗,运维岗,测试岗),想转后台开发岗位的在职工程师

5.工作中技术没有挑战,工作中接触不到新技术的在职工程师

6.自己研究学习速度较慢,不能系统构建知识体系的开发人员

7.了解很多技米名词,但是深入细问又不理解的工程师

8.自己研究学习速度较慢,不能系统构建知识体系的开发人员了解很多技米名词,但是深入细问又不理解的工程师

课程方式介绍:课程是在腾讯课堂以直播的形式教学

1.98次直播课,持续8个半月,直播每周二四六晚8点到10点

2.课前预习资料课后思考实践作业

3.班主任督学作业统计博客统计

4.老师答疑工作问题课程问题

5.课程涉及编程语言45%的c,25%的c++,20%的go,5%的lua,5%的其他语言(Rust, shell, java, awk, python)

6.奖学金机制最高1000元,公开透明(一-期评选一-次)

课程优势:

1.简历梳理技术点凸显项目技术梳理

2.模拟面试技术表述

3.薪资谈判福利争取

4.offer选择职业规划技术前景

往期学员学习过程的心得总结:

1.学习要有主动性。无论是开始的自学,还是后面的培训学习,学习的主观能动性一定要有,特别是报班学习之后,不要觉得万事有老师,外部的辅导条件能够让你有更好的学习效率和氛围,但是最终需要掌握技能的还是你自己的,所以学习的过程不要懈怠。

2.学完技术内容之后,要形成自己的技术栈体系。我在学完之后,就根据我自己的技术内容花了三天时间整理一份c/c++后端开发需要掌握的技术体系路线图,来帮助自己梳理自己所学的技术点。

3.善于总结自己的学习过程。每当自己学完一个小块的知识点之后,最好是将自己对它的理解整理成博客文章,这样既能自我梳理自己的学习成果,又能作为自己在面试工作时向面试官展现的一个亮点。

4.一定要复盘自己的面试过程。在我学习之后的面试过程,并不是一帆风顺。但是我在老师的建议下,不管成功的还是失败的面试过程,场场复盘!找出自己回答的不好的地方做备注修改,这样一次次下来,对于面试,我也是越来越胸有成竹。

5.学习方式,不管黑猫白猫,抓住老鼠的就是好猫。对于也想从事或是转行到c/c++后端开发岗的兄弟,如果考虑报班培训的话,可以推荐大家了解一下我之前学习过的课程,整个课程体系对标的是腾讯的T9级别。

相关学习文档资料包、视频获取:

Linux C++后端开发相关视频,文档代码资料包,学习路线思维导图免费领取

课程大纲思维导图

课程内容总结:

一:精进基是专栏

二、高性能网络专栏

三、基础组件设计专栏

四、中间件开发专栏

五、开源框架专栏

六、云原生专栏

七、性能分析专栏

八、分布式架构专栏

九、上线项目实战

成果数据展现

课程总结:

现在的技术的学习曲线的增加,让我的忍耐性越来越低。各种新技术,因为新奇让人兴奋,但最终变成一场场争论。我越来越无法忍受这些充满市场宣传气息的喧嚣。我对技术看重的是稳定,清晰。

据不完全统计,截至目前(2018.07)为止,中国C++程序员的数量已经超过了100万。而且,随着IT培训业的持续发展和大量的应届毕业生进入社会,C++程序员面临的竞争压力越来越大。那么,作为一名C++程序员,怎样努力才能快速成长为一名高级的程序员或者架构师,或者说一名优秀的高级工程师或架构师应该有怎样的技术知识体系,这不仅是一个刚刚踏入职场的初级程序员,也是工作三五年之后开始迷茫的老程序员,都必须要面对和想明白的问题。

技术的瓶颈是认知的问题, 认知不是知其名,还需要知其因,更需要知其原。

最后祝大家都学有所成。

### 教育 C++ Qt 课程资源概述 教育提供了多门针对C++和Qt技术栈的高质量视频课程,这些课程旨在帮助开发者深入了解Qt框架及其应用开发技巧。对于那些已经在业务开发领域工作了一段时间但希望进一步探索底层机制和技术细节的人来说尤为适合[^2]。 #### 提供的具体课程包括: - **QT界面美化视频课程** 这一课程专注于如何创建美观且用户体验良好的图形用户界面应用程序。通过实际案例教学,学员可以掌握多种设计模式以及最佳实践方法来提升UI质量[^1]。 - **QT性能优化视频课程** 性能问题是大型项目中常见的挑战之一,在此系列教程里将会详细介绍有关提高程序运行效率的各种策略和技术手段,比如内存管理、线程处理等方面的知识点。 - **QT原理与源码分析视频课程** 对于想要更深层次理解Qt内部运作方式的学习者来说是非常有价值的资料。该部分会带领大家逐步剖析核心组件的工作流程,并解释其背后的算法逻辑。 - **QT QML C++扩展开发视频课程** 结合QML这种明式的语言特性与强大的C++编程能力来进行跨平台移动应用或者桌面软件的研发。这不仅能够加速原型构建过程,同时也赋予了产品更高的灵活性和可维护性。 除了上述提到的内容之外,还有其他丰富的学习材料可供参考,例如由第三方分享的一份包含大量实用链接及文档下载地址在内的资源包也十分有用处[^3]。 ```bash # 下载额外的学习资源 wget https://download.csdn.net/download/mamor/89692958 -O qt_learning_resources.zip unzip qt_learning_resources.zip 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值